Is this a buggy error or am I just missing something? My fiancee's visa got approved and issued(!) at the Bogota embassy, and now it's time to schedule an appointment to pick it up. The email from the embassy says to use this site. Every time I log in, this is all I see. Just the groups page. The blacked out name/email is my fiancee's info - it's plain text, not a link or anything. I've tried with different browsers, even tried using my phone, nada.

Unsurprisingly, it was just user error. There was an email that directed me to schedule an interview. It sent me to the non-immigrant visa area of usvisa-info. And the K-1 business is handled in the immigrant visa area of the website. Once I hit the "IV" switch at the bottom right, all got sorted out.
